Abstract
The utility model discloses a kind of speed reducers,Including housing,The housing central section is equipped with output shaft,The output shaft one side connects drive end bearing bracket,The drive end bearing bracket one side is equipped with hole baffle ring,The hole connects bearing with baffle ring one side,Connection bearing block below the bearing,The bearing block one side is equipped with gear one,One medial surface of gear is equipped with pin hole,The one one side connection gear two of gear,Two one side of gear connects transition axis,The transition axis afterbody connects electric machine main shaft,The transition axis one side connects rear end cap,The rear end cap one side connects motor bearings door,Gear three is equipped in the middle part of the electric machine main shaft,The three lower section connection motor stator of gear,The three top connection rotor of gear,The rotor one side is equipped with fan blade,The speed reducer,By rear end cap,Housing,Drive end bearing bracket,Pass through gear,Bearing etc. is connected.By the Unique physical design of housing, realize that gear assembly is directly realized by engaged transmission without by other parts in housing.The novel design, completing transmission needs part to be applied few.

Housing 1 is cast iron materials, and the hardness of cast iron materials is bigger, and easily shaping, also can during manufacture
It is more prone to manufacture, stationarity can also be guaranteed.There is nitrile rubber 18 to be sealed between drive end bearing bracket 3 and hole baffle ring 4,
It is sealed using nitrile rubber, can prevent the leakage of lubricating oil, the in vivo fluid of case is allow efficiently to use.Bearing 5
For deep groove ball bearing, deep groove ball bearing substantial radial load can also bear axial load and radial load simultaneously, axis
Stress potentially unstable, ability deep groove ball bearing can protect axis uniform stressed, will not damage.Bearing block 6 is whole for one with housing 1
Body, the two can be more prone to processing for an entirety, avoid increasing connector, can save material, while be linked as one
Entirety can make bearing not shake in stress, and structure is more firm.Transition axis 10 passes through shaft coupling with electric machine main shaft 11
Device 19 connects, and is attached using shaft coupling so that simpler quick during installation, dismounting is convenient to, together
When two axis connection even closer can also consolidate, during rotation, will not get loose.
